Abstract
The present invention relates to new hydrogel materials using water gellants that are comprised by hydrophilic polymers to which hydrogen bonding units are covalently attached. Optionally, the hydrogel contains additional ingredients or additives. These new reversible hydrogels can easily be fine-tuned in their mechanical performance and functionality and are especially suitable for cosmetic and biomedical applications.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A hydrogel composition comprising:
(a) 0.3-50.0 wt. %, based on the total weight of the hydrogel composition, of a water gellant comprising a hydrophilic polymer to which at least two 4H-units are covalently attached, wherein the 4H-unit has the general formula (3) or formula (4) and tautomers thereof:
wherein X is nitrogen atom or a carbon atom bearing a substituent R 15 , and
wherein the 4H-unit is bonded to a polymer backbone via R 1 and R 2 or via R 1 and R 3 with the other R groups representing, independently a side chain according to (i)-(viii);
(i) hydrogen;
(ii) C 1 -C 20 alkyl;
(iii) C 6 -C 12 aryl;
(iv) C 7 -C 12 alkaryl;
(v) C 7 -C 12 alkyl aryl;
(vi) polyester groups having the formula (5)
wherein R 4 and Y are independently selected from the group consisting of hydrogen and C 1 -C 6 linear or branched alkyl, n is 1-6 and m is 10 to 100;
(vii) C 1 -C 10 alkyl groups substituted with 1-4 ureido groups according to the formula (6):
R 5 —NH—C(O)—NH— (6)
wherein R 5 is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en and C 1 -C 6 linear or branched alkyl;
(viii) polyether groups having the formula (7)
wherein R 6 , R 7 and Y are independently selected from the group consisting of hydrogen and C 1 -C 6 linear or branched alkyl and o is 10-100;
(b) 50.0 to 99.7 wt. % water, based on the total weight of hydrogel;
(c) a polar solvent other than water, wherein the polar solvent comprises less than 15 wt. % of the total weight of the hydrogel composition; and
wherein components (a)-(c) form a hydrogel.
2. The hydrogel composition according to claim 1 , wherein 2-50 4H-units are covalently attached to the hydrophilic polymer.
